Understanding Electronic Health Record Systems
Electronic health record systems serve as digital versions of patient charts, storing medical histories, diagnoses, medications, and treatment plans. These medical records software solutions enable healthcare providers to access comprehensive patient information from a centralized database. Unlike paper-based systems, EHR platforms allow multiple authorized users to view and update records simultaneously.
Many practices explore EMR medical software options that integrate clinical documentation with administrative functions. Patient health record software typically includes features like medication lists, allergy tracking, immunization records, and laboratory results. Solutions from providers such as Epic and Cerner demonstrate how comprehensive platforms can streamline workflows. The transition from manual documentation to digital systems can reduce errors and improve care coordination across different healthcare settings.
Cloud based EMR systems offer accessibility advantages, allowing practitioners to review patient information from various locations with internet connectivity. These platforms often include automatic backup features and regular software updates managed by the vendor. Security measures such as encryption and user authentication help protect sensitive health information while maintaining compliance with privacy regulations.
Specialized Solutions for Different Practice Types
Different medical specialties require tailored functionality within their software platforms. Dental software includes features like digital radiography integration, treatment planning tools, and periodontal charting capabilities. Practices focusing on mental health may seek EMR for small psychiatry practice that includes session notes templates, treatment protocols, and outcome measurement tools specific to behavioral health.
Urgent care EHR software prioritizes rapid patient intake and documentation for walk-in visits, often incorporating triage protocols and quick-reference clinical decision support. Meanwhile, lab electronic health records EHR system solutions connect directly with diagnostic equipment and manage specimen tracking throughout the testing process. Platforms like athenahealth and Allscripts offer specialty-specific modules that address unique workflow requirements.
Home healthcare software addresses the needs of providers delivering services in patient residences, with features for route optimization, mobile documentation, and coordination with family caregivers. Home health management software often includes scheduling tools that account for travel time and geographic service areas. These specialized platforms recognize that different care settings demand distinct functionality beyond general-purpose medical management systems.
Core Features in Medical Management Software
Medical management software encompasses several interconnected functions that support daily operations. Medical appointment software handles scheduling, sends automated reminders, and manages provider calendars to optimize patient flow. These systems can reduce no-show rates and improve resource utilization through waitlist management and real-time availability displays.
Healthcare billing software automates claim submission, tracks reimbursement status, and manages payment posting. Integration between clinical documentation and billing modules helps ensure that services rendered are accurately captured and coded. Companies like Kareo and AdvancedMD provide combined solutions that connect clinical and financial workflows within a single platform.
Clinic management software coordinates administrative tasks including patient registration, insurance verification, and document management. Healthcare management software may also include reporting tools that track key performance indicators such as patient volume, revenue cycles, and clinical outcomes. These analytics capabilities help practice administrators identify operational trends and make informed decisions about resource allocation and process improvements.

Healthcare Data Management and Integration
Healthcare data management involves organizing, storing, and securing patient information across multiple systems and formats. Interoperability standards enable different platforms to exchange information, reducing duplicate data entry and improving care coordination. Integration with laboratory systems, imaging centers, and pharmacy networks enhances the completeness of patient records available to clinicians.
Modern health management software often supports application programming interfaces that connect with third-party tools such as patient portals, telemedicine platforms, and population health analytics. These connections create ecosystems where information flows between applications without manual intervention. Solutions from vendors like NextGen Healthcare and eClinicalWorks emphasize interoperability as a core platform capability.
Data security measures within medical software include role-based access controls, audit trails, and encryption protocols. Regular system backups and disaster recovery planning protect against data loss from technical failures or security incidents. Compliance with privacy regulations requires software vendors to implement safeguards that protect patient confidentiality while enabling appropriate information sharing among authorized healthcare team members.
